What This Stop Order Means
Florida Statute 581.217 governs the distribution, retail sale, and marketing of hemp extract products. Violations include selling hemp products through unlicensed channels, marketing hemp extract with unapproved health claims, distributing products without required testing documentation, or advertising hemp in ways that violate Florida's consumer protection standards. Products subject to these stop-sales are pulled from shelves immediately — they cannot be sold, transferred, or given away until FDACS approves a release.
When FDACS issues a Distribution/Retail Sale and Advertising/Marketing stop-sale order, the establishment must immediately cease selling or distributing the flagged products. Products remain under stop-sale order until FDACS inspectors verify corrective action has been taken.
Hemp products marketed with unapproved health claims mislead consumers into using them as medical treatments, potentially delaying evidence-based care. Products distributed through unregulated channels may contain undisclosed substances, inaccurate potency labeling, or contaminants not present in legitimate retail products.
43 of 742 cited establishments have received distribution/retail sale and advertising/marketing stop-sale orders on more than one inspection visit — a pattern that raises questions about whether underlying compliance issues are being fully resolved.
